When Larry Page and Sergey Brin started Google in 1995, they acknowledged that although existing search engines like Yahoo could assist customers find pertinent web sites, they could not effectively establish which results were genuinely high quality. Web page and Brin observed that academic community currently had a proxy for quality: citations. A citation shows that the initial job is dependable and significant adequate to referral.

Google, for that reason, constructed its search engine with the back links as the digital equivalent of a citation, where even more internet site back links suggest better. Other search engines did the same. Considering that then, internet search engine' top quality step has come to be much more nuanced, but the core concept holds: back links are a vital sign of your website's high quality and a foundation of search engine optimization success.




Back links can result in any web see it here page on your site; they do not require to link to your homepage to be considered back links. Backlinks stand out from interior web links, which are links within your website (Backlinks). For instance, if your homepage web links to your about page, that connect is interior and not a backlink.


Spiders adhere to links in the anchor text to uncover new web pages and content, then index the web pages for the online search engine. To put it simply, crawlers feed Google information concerning backlinks to your site to establish its relevance and value for specific search inquiries. Not all back links are equivalent in the eyes of an online search engine.

These are necessary for SEO due to the fact that when a website has a follow link indicating it, it signals to browse engines that the site is trustworthy and reliable. (If a web link isn't or else identified by spiders or HTML, it's a comply with link.) Sites can add a piece of HTML called nofollow to their external links.


There are a few usual factors you may do this. Online forums or social media sites websites nofollow their web links since they can't control what their users share. Blogs established links in their comment sections to nofollow to prevent spam websites from commenting with web links in an effort to build relevance with Google.


The most usual spam web links are blog comment spam and links from web link farms (sites without a real following that just exist to provide backlinks to various other sites). Sites that have actually been around for a very long time commonly have old internet pages that are no much longer live. This generally takes place to unique promo pages or throughout a site rebuild.


If the site takes down the page, they lose the value of the backlinks it acquired because the links lead to a dead web page. Assessing your old web pages and placing them back live or establishing long-term redirect guidelines (301 redirects) is an excellent method to generate backlinks. Among the best ways to get backlinks naturallywithout doing outreach to specific sitesis to produce and share solid informational web content.


Viewers will then normally link to your website as a useful additional source within their material. Expect your golf brand creates a post titled "The Clear-cut Guide to Picking the Right 9-iron" see this and shares it on social media sites. Another blogger can then stumble upon the piece, locate value, and include it to their longer short article on selecting the right clubs as a helpful extra source in the 9-iron section.
